Vagina

An internal organ located between the legs. A person may be born with a vagina or have one surgically created. When referring to genitals, the Trans Care BC website uses "internal genitals (vagina)" for trans people assigned female at birth (AFAB), and "vagina" or "vagina with vaginoplasty" for trans people assigned male at birth (AMAB), but there are many different terms that individuals may use.

Vaginectomy

A surgical procedure that involves the removal of vaginal tissue and the closure of the genital opening (vaginal canal).

Vaginoplasty

A gender-affirming genital surgery to create a vulva (including mons, labia, clitoris and urethral opening) and vagina.

Vocal feminization surgery

A gender-affirming surgery to elevate the pitch of the voice.

Vulvoplasty

A gender-affirming genital surgery to create a vulva (including mons, labia, clitoris and urethral opening) and remove the penis, scrotum and testes. Vulvoplasty creates the external aspects of a vulva without creation of a vaginal canal.
